Juliet May

Director

Juliet May is an award-winning director.

Over the years, she has directed some of the most iconic television to grace our screens, including the first three series of Miranda, three series of Call the Midwife, series four of Last Tango in Halifax and seasons one and two of the critically acclaimed Motherland for the BBC.

Juliet also won an Emmy for her feature-length TV drama Dustbin Baby for BBC1 and a Royal Television Society Award and BAFTA for the children’s comedy series, Microsoap.
